    The most experienced mesothelioma law firms will offer a variety of legal options to assist victims and their loved ones. For instance, they could file a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it against asbestos producers. They may also make a claim against an asbestos trust fund.

    A lawsuit can allow victims to receive compensation for many of their expenses, such as medical bills and wages lost. Additionally, a wrongful death lawsuit can pay compensation to family members for the loss of a loved ones.

    Typically between 80 to 92 percent of mesothelioma cases settle before they reach the trial stage. This is due to the fact that defendants seek to avoid costly verdicts. Additionally, a settlement allows them to avoid appeals that could hold up the payment of compensation.

    Asbestos sufferers can get financial aid from bankruptcy trusts, who have set the goal of helping $30 billion asbestos victims. There are currently asbestos trust funds administered by Johns Manville, ITT Corp and Goulds Pumps Inc. These and other big companies are defendants in mesothelioma cases. They were aware of asbestos' risks but did not warn their employees or clients. Asbestos-related victims should consult an attorney for mesothelioma about their asbestos exposure history to determine which asbestos trusts they could make a claim with. They can also discuss other sources of financial support including federal and state compensation programs and veteran benefits.

    Gathering evidence is the initial step to pursuing a mesothelioma cancer case. This includes medical records, work histories and military service papers. The mesothelioma lawyers also require a list of asbestos-containing products and their manufacturers. Once the attorneys have all this information, then they will examine the case to decide which court system would be the best option for the lawsuit.
